FDR Library Unveils "Signature Moments" Exhibit
Source: The FDR Library's special Exhibit "Signature Moments" showcases letters to the Roosevelts (2025-06-28)
The FDR Library's special exhibit, "Signature Moments," highlights a collection of letters addressed to the Roosevelts, offering a unique glimpse into their personal and historical connections. Visitors can explore these significant correspondences that reveal the impact and legacy of Franklin and Eleanor Roosevelt. The exhibit is part of the library's effort to celebrate key moments in history through intimate artifacts. It provides an engaging opportunity for the public to connect with the Roosevelt era and understand the personal stories behind major events.
